Bug Description
Binary package hint: evince
This is either a problem with evince or cups
I was recently printing off lots of PDF files using Evince. All of them printed off OK except one - which the printer refused to print on numerous occasions, coming back with error messages each time. All the files contain Chinese characters - both those that would print and the one file that wouldn't.
I have attached the troubleshoot.txt that the printing tool produced as well as the culprit PDF file.
